The Graduate Certificate in Predictive Analytics for Recruitment is a specialized program designed to equip students with the skills and knowledge required to apply predictive analytics techniques in recruitment and talent management.
By completing this program, students will gain a deep understanding of predictive analytics and its applications in recruitment, including data mining, machine learning, and statistical modeling.
The learning outcomes of this program include the ability to analyze large datasets, develop predictive models, and interpret results in a recruitment context, as well as the ability to communicate complex analytics insights to stakeholders.
The duration of the program is typically 6-12 months, depending on the institution and the student's prior experience and qualifications.
The Graduate Certificate in Predictive Analytics for Recruitment is highly relevant to the recruitment industry, as it addresses the growing need for data-driven decision-making in talent acquisition and management.
Employers in the recruitment industry are increasingly looking for professionals who can apply predictive analytics techniques to improve their recruitment processes, and this program provides students with the skills and knowledge required to meet this demand.
Graduates of this program can expect to find employment in a variety of roles, including recruitment analyst, talent analyst, and data scientist, and can pursue further study in areas such as machine learning and artificial intelligence.
